Prefab House USA completed a compact 20-foot tiny house on wheels and listed the unit for sale with an asking price of approximately US$39,000 on February 23, 2026. The unit is a towable, single-axle-sized build intended for two-person occupancy and positioned around affordability rather than luxury finishes.

The shell measures 20 feet in length and rides on a trailer chassis so it can be moved with a suitable tow vehicle. Prefab House USA described the model as a simple, towable home oriented to two-person living and emphasizing a low entry price point for buyers seeking a moveable primary dwelling or a secondary small home.

Prefab House USA set the asking price at about US$39,000, making this listing one of the lower-priced factory-built towables currently offered directly by a prefab builder. The company completed the unit before listing it for sale, presenting it as a ready-to-purchase option rather than a long lead-time custom order.

The February 23, 2026 listing targets buyers who need a compact, towable footprint with immediate availability and a sub-six-figure price signal. Prefab House USA’s approach with this 20-foot model emphasizes keeping purchase cost front and center, in contrast to higher-end tiny houses that bundle custom work and extended build schedules.
